I’ve been visiting Greenlanes most weekends for two years now(and have just moved nearby), and it just continues to surprise and excite me. Hala has just opened up in the space left next by the departed Café Lime(next to Café Lemon, going for maximum imagination round these parts). The people here are incredibly friendly for starters. Imagine three rather worse for wear individuals bumbling into your restaurant at 9.30 on a Saturday night after a day at the cricket. Wearing penguin suits. Too many places would sneer or turn people away — this lot on the other hand furnished us with menus and helped us decide on a feast fit for a king(penguin). We chatted to the head chef who said he’d make us up the house special — mixed grill for two with a few extras to bump it up to feed three. We put away lots of bread, yoghurt and salad while we were waiting — the bread is as it is everywhere round these parts, soft and pillowy with just enough chew. The salad was great — refreshing with tomatoes, lemon juice and superb small olives. And then. Oh and then, the kebab arrived. I have never seen such a plate of beauty. We had a little of everything from the menu — chicken wings, lamb and chicken shish, proper bits of adana and lamb patties — my god, it was good. So so good. It all came in on a huge bed of fluffy and slightly creamy rice that I could have eaten on its own. We waddled off into the night as only drunk and stuffed penguins can. Very, very happy. Well done Hala.

The only place on Green Lanes which can compete with the spectacle of Antepliler. Two women in the window churn out mountains of fresh gozleme, ready to be cooked to order. I regularly stop in here for a gozleme to take away, which is excellent value and close to the best snack going on the Lanes. It’s a toss up between gozleme from here or lahmacun from Antepliler, but if you’re in a hurry this is definately the place to go as the service is much more efficient at Hala. If you are stopping for a sit down meal, the menu also includes the usual turkish collection, and the daily stews are of a particularly good standard.

The kids being fascinated by the ladies in the window making gozleme(as we found out when we went in), we decided to have a bit of tea here. The place used to be Café Lime and apart from the enormous cooking area that has now appeared, the décor is much the same, wooden panelling and muted colours. Being teatime, it was very busy but we didn’t have to wait for either service or our food both of which were very good. We went for a big plate of Gozleme: Potato, Spinach, minced lamb, and cheese flavoured, washed down with the fanciest Ayrans on Green Lanes. All Delicious! The menu also has all the other stuff you might expect; kebebs, pide, meze, fish but a quick nose round the table and the speed with which the other customers finished them off suggested that the other food on offer was equally good. Price: 5 gozleme and 2 ayrans = £12. Highchair available and kids made very welcome.
